In other news,
Tiger Brands appointed Lawrence MacDougall as CEO. He is currently executive vice president and regional president at Mondelez International for Eastern Europe, the Middle East and Africa. Noel Doyle will continue to serve as acting CEO until MacDougall joins the organisation. And South Africa's online marketplace
bidorbuy.co.za announced the addition of Bitcoin as a payment method through its partnership with BitX. For more on how it works and the advantages of enabling bitcoin payments, read
Bidorbuy now taking bitcoins.
Lastly, Vincent Hoogduijn, CEO for Media 24's e-commerce division, explains why the
slow adoption of e-commerce is more of an offline problem than an online one. "The underlying reason that e-commerce is not growing as fast as it should be in SA is not due to the online experience. Retail is over-developed in SA, and it's not helping e-commerce..."
